Where does “ธารน้ำแข็ง” come from?
ธารน้ำแข็ง (Thai) comes from Thai ธาร, from Sanskrit धारा, from Proto-Indo-Aryan dʰā́raH, from Proto-Indo-Iranian dʰā́raH, from Proto-Indo-European dʰórh₃-eh₂, from Proto-Indo-European dʰerh₃- — to leap, spring.
ธารน้ำแข็ง (Thai): glacier
